The Ohio Dept. of Taxation has begun sending failure to file notices to taxpayers who haven’t filed Form SD 100 “Ohio School District Income Tax Return” for tax years 2017, 2018 and 2019, and who live in a taxing school district based on the school district number or mailing address reported on the taxpayer’s Ohio Form IT-1040. Failure to respond to the notice will result in the issuance of an assessment and further collection action that may subject taxpayers to additional interest and penalties.
